“People’s libraries” of the Society of zealots of Russian historical enlightenment at the turn of the 19th and 20th centuries
At the beginning of the reign of Nicholas II, representatives of the conservativeoriented élite and their supporters from other social strata established the Society of Zealots of Russian Historical Enlightenment in memory of Emperor Alexander III with the aims of maintaining the ideological course...
